Subject: Reply-to munging

Please change the list to stop munging reply-to headers. See this for a
slew of reasons why it is bad:
http://www.unicom.com/pw/reply-to-harmful.html
The most annoying to me are that it breaks my ability to reply to the
original poster off list when I feel it is appropriate, and to properly
reply to threads which are cross posted to more than one list.
